Portsmouth vs Keene
Side-by-side comparison
How does Portsmouth, NH compare to Keene, NH? Portsmouth has a population of 22,332 with a median household income of $105,756, while Keene has 22,923 residents and a median income of $78,183.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Portsmouth, NH | Keene, NH |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 22,332 | 22,923 | -2.6% |
| Median Age | 42.4 | 35.9 | +18.1% |
| Foreign Born % | 9.2% | 3.8% | +142.1% |
| Metric | Portsmouth | Keene |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$105,756 | $78,183 | +35.3% |
| Unemployment | 2.1% | 1.5% | +40.0% |
| Poverty Rate | 5.5% | 9.9% | -44.4% |
| Bachelor's+ | 63.4% | 43.4% | +46.1% |
| Metric | Portsmouth | Keene |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$640,600 | $232,500 | +175.5% |
| Median Rent | $1778/mo | $1275/mo | +39.5% |
| Housing Units | 11,094 | 10,271 | +8.0% |
